Paulette N. Pratte

September 4, 1943 — May 20, 2021

Paulette N. Pratte, 77, of Berlin, passed away on Thursday May 20, 2021 at the Dartmouth Hitchcock Medical Center in Lebanon. She was born in Beauceville, PQ, Canada on September 4, 1943 the daughter of Felix and Marie-Ange (Poulin) Poulin and came to the United States in 1952 when she was 9 years old and has lived in NH since then. She had been employed in several places in Berlin, most recently for Senior Meals as a cook. Paulette was a devout Catholic and was a member of St. Joseph Parish, now Good Shepherd Parish. She liked to knit and crochet, garden, watching QVC and cooking shows and was always improving on her impressive cooking skills. Paulette was a very feisty, courageous, no-nonsense woman who wasn’t afraid to speak her mind. She was also a very giving person who cared very much for her family.
